发明名称 Methods for zero loss and nonstop packet processing during system software upgrades
摘要 A method implemented in a network component for an in-service software upgrade (ISSU), the method comprising selecting a forwarding core (FC) for upgrade from a plurality of FCs that run at a data plane on a printed circuit board of the network component to process and forward a plurality of packets, and resetting the selected FC with a software upgrade, wherein at least one of the other FCs continues processing and forwarding packets when the selected FC is upgraded.

主权项 1. A method implemented in a network component for an in-service software upgrade (ISSU), the method comprising: forwarding a plurality of packets with a plurality of forwarding cores (FCs) implemented on a processor; selecting, using the network component, a first FC from the plurality of FCs for a software upgrade; resetting, using the network component, the first FC with the software upgrade without resetting at least one of the other FCs from the plurality of FCs implemented on the processor, wherein the at least one of the other FCs from the plurality of FCs forwards the packets when the selected FC is upgraded, transmitting a reset command to the first FC to stop at least one of the following: polling packets from a shared buffer by the first FC and responding to an input/output (IO) interrupt for the first FC; and offloading, using the network component, the packets allocated for the first FC from the shared buffer to the at least one of the other FCs, wherein the offloaded packets are queued in a high priority buffer that is accessed by the at least one of the other FCs for forwarding.
